Clay Mask #1 Rhassoul clay ~ Rhassoul Clay has been used for centuries for its amazing skin and hair nurturing properties. It can be used in a skin purifying and remineralising mask, as a deep clean/detox hair treatment, as an anti-cellulite scrub, and in many other ways. It is carefully selected and mined from ancient mineral-rich deposits in the Atlas Mountains of Morocco, then packaged for you in the USA. Rhassoul clay is an extremely efficient clay for face masks, while being gentler than Bentonite Clay, which can be hard to mix and also too harsh on dry and sensitive skin - Rhassoul Clay mixes easily to a paste and is also more suitable for a wider range of skin types. Use it whenever you want to get softer, smoother skin, close your pores, deep clean your skin and help clear up break-outs.
Hibiscus flower powder ~ Hibiscus flower contains nearly 30% plant acids and the topical benefit is quite amazing, as this acid is very anti-inflammatory as well as skin toning. Hibiscus extracts are being found more and more often in facial serums and toners.
Hawthorn berry powder ~ said to increase circulation and stimulate new cell growth, this berry powder has long been used in topical applications of hair tonics and conditioners. It also adds a very gentle additional texture to the blend to aid with exfoliation.
Nettle leaf powder ~ nettle leaf is very high in Chlorophyll and Vitamins A, B, C, D and K, as well as multiple minerals. Ironically, even though the live plant gives a painful sting, when dried it is a great anti-inflammatory and also helps reduce redness and itchiness.
Rosehip powder ~ you've probably read about rosehip oil and its use either on its own or in skin moisturizing blends, but rosehip powder also packs a punch. It's extremely high in Vitamin C and has also been shown to be a powerful anti-inflammatory in clinical trials
Pebble Botanicals #1 Hydrosol Blend A delicately scented blend of organic 'floral waters' obtained by steam distilling organic flowers, leaves and fruit. Contains:
Aloe vera (Aloe barbadensis) ~ Known as the medicine plant, aloe products are often used to treat burns, infections and to accelerate the body's natural healing process. In addition, aloe is a wonderful skin softener and conditioner.
Calendula (Calendula officinalis) ~ Calendula is another well-known natural skincare hero, and no wonder since it holds a variety of therapeutic benefits. As a facial toner, this flower is said to help stimulate the growth of collagen produced naturally by our body, which diminishes gradually over time and which results in the appearance of wrinkles and lines. Calendula is also anti-bacterial and assists with topical pain management of minor skin abrasions and small cuts as well as blemishes and acne.
Comfrey (Symphytum officinale) ~ Comfrey has been used for thousands of years in natural medicine for its amazing skin healing properties. Scientists have found that this leaf contains high amounts of natural allantoin, which encourages the rapid re-growth of cells.
Ginger (Zingiber officinale) ~ Ginger is one of the best detoxifiers known to man and it is gaining popularity in restorative detox teas and herbal lattes. This quality makes this hydrosol water an excellent addition to clay face masks, to further enhance the drawing of toxins from the skin.
Green tea (Camellia sinensis) ~ Many studies have been performed on the use of green tea products in cosmetics. These studies show that green tea is a great anti-inflammatory, and it also contains a high level of polyphenols which are key in the ongoing fight against the signs of aging.
Helichrysum (Helichrysum arenarium) ~ Helichrysum is well known for its skin toning and healing properties, especially for mature and/or very dry skin. Herbalists also use it in pain remedy formulas for bruises, sprains and sore muscles.
Sweet orange (Citrus sinensis) ~ Orange oil is known for its antibacterial, anti-inflammatory, and fungicidal benefits. It also imparts a very subtle yet uplifting scent to the blend.
Papaya leaf (Carica papaya) ~ There is a lot of excitement in the skincare world around the active enzymes in papaya. It has cleansing and antibacterial properties, and also helps to brighten the complexion.
Raspberry Leaf (Rubus idaeus) ~ Red raspberry leaf is another rising star in skincare. It is naturally astringent, which helps tone and tighten the skin. It contains tannins which have been studied for their ability to stimulate skin cell regeneration. This leaf is also packed with flavonoids and elagic acid which are both antioxidant and anti-inflammatory compounds. It is a fabulous addition to any skincare regime, but in particular for mature and aging skin.
Vanilla bean (Vanilla planifolia) ~ Antioxidants like vanilla oil are believed to assist with cell regeneration, and fighting the signs of aging caused by free radicals. Vanilla is naturally antibacterial, which will also assist those with pimply, or acne prone skin. Vanilla is well known for its aromatherapy benefits, calming nerves and helping you to relax.
